Affinity Gaming is seeking an experienced Senior Buyer - Food & Beverage (F&B) to join the Corporate Purchasing team. As part of the team, you will be working out of the corporate office in Las Vegas, NV, and will be responsible for managing all procurement activities for the Food & Beverage departments across all Affinity Gaming locations.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Source and purchase products as requested by each food and beverage department while ensuring quality and meeting business needs
  • Review department purchase requisitions to ensure adequate details and approvals are provided prior to processing
  • Create Purchase Orders (PO) and coordinate with receiving to monitor delivery of items purchased
  • Expedite orders and arrange best new delivery dates in the event of a delay
  • Source and present substitute (like) items to requestor for items out of stock or delayed
  • Research and identify new suppliers for food and beverage items
  • Prepare and manage RFPs and RFQs
  • Lead the development, negotiation, and execution of contracts with suppliers to ensure quality, cost-efficiency, and timely delivery
  • Build and maintain strong supplier relationships for a reliable supply chain
  • Continuously track food and beverage market trends, commodity prices, and potential risks to inform purchasing decisions
  • Identify and log savings opportunities
  • Collaborate with F&B and Marketing departments to properly plan and execute orders for new menu rollouts, special events, etc.
  • Schedule tastings, cuttings, sample reviews as needed/requested
  • Create and maintain item numbers and specifications within the purchasing system
  • Review and resolve invoice variances with accounts payable in a timely manner
  • Communicate clearly, professionally and effectively with vendors and internal customers at all times
  • Assist F&B departments with budgeting and forecasting
  • Performs other duties as may be assigned
  • All duties to be performed in accordance with departmental and Affinity Gaming’s programs, policies, and procedures

E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E:

  • Bachelor’s degree and 3 years of Food & Beverage procurement experience or equivalent education and related experience.
  • Culinary experience is a plus. 
  • Strong computer skills working with Microsoft Word, Excel, Teams, Stratton Warren, RedRock, Zoom.
  • Capable of analyzing data, making data-driven decisions, and developing “should-cost” models.
  • Strong interpersonal, time management and teamwork skills.
  • Ability to train F&B staff on the procurement/inventory system.
  • Communicate effectively to all levels of the organization with excellent written and verbal skills.

LICENSES, CERTIFICATIONS OR REGISTRATIONS:

  • Minimum 21 years of age.
  • Must possess a local valid driver license.
  • Must obtain and maintain multiple gaming licenses if required.
